Local tips

  • Visit during the spring and summer months to see the roses in full bloom.
  • Bring a picnic to enjoy on the grassy areas or under the shade of the trees.
  • Take advantage of guided tours available for deeper insights into the park's history and flora.
  • Check the park's schedule for seasonal events and flower shows for an enhanced visit.
  • Wear comfortable shoes as there are many walking paths to explore throughout the park.

Discover more about Elizabeth Park Conservancy

Elizabeth Park Conservancy is a stunning horticultural haven located in West Hartford, Connecticut. Renowned for its vibrant rose garden, which boasts over 15,000 blooming roses, this expansive park serves as a peaceful retreat for locals and visitors alike. Spanning 102 acres, the park features meticulously maintained gardens, scenic walking paths, and a variety of historical monuments that narrate the story of the park's rich past. Visitors can stroll through the beautifully landscaped areas, enjoy seasonal blooms, and soak in the tranquil atmosphere that envelops the park year-round. The park is not just a feast for the eyes; it also offers ample opportunities for outdoor activities, such as picnicking, jogging, or simply unwinding amidst nature. The historic Olmsted Brothers designed the park, and their influence is evident in the thoughtful layout and integration of natural elements. Throughout the year, Elizabeth Park also hosts various events, from flower shows to cultural festivals, making it a vibrant community hub.
